Brief summary
To assess the change in hemoglobin levels when iron sucrose was added to a regimen of weekly, fixed doses of erythropoietin in patients who had or had not responded to erythropoietin therapy alone.
Detailed description
This was a two stage, randomized, controlled study of cancer patients undergoing or planning to undergo chemotherapy. After stage one, (where patients were exposed to an erythropoiesis stimulating agent), patients were randomized to receive either IV iron sucrose or no iron supplementation. Patients were then followed to safety and efficacy endpoints.

Eligibility
Inclusion criteria
* Histological Diagnosis of Cancer * Hgb \</= 10 * Ongoing or Planned Chemotherapy * Body Weight \>50kg * Free of Active Infection * Karnofsky Status 60% to 100%
Exclusion criteria
* Active infection * Use of Multivitamins with iron within one week of entry * Myelophthisic bone marrow involvement by tumor except hematologic malignancy * Concurrent medical condition that would prevent compliance or jeopardize the health of the patient * Use of any IV iron products within two months of study entry * Blood Transfusions * Hypoplastic bone marrow failure state * Acute Leukemia * Myeloproliferative syndrome * Uncontrolled hypertension

Participants by arm
| Arm | Count |
|---|---|
| Group A: Erythropoietin + Venofer (Responders) Subjects who at any time during Stage 1 (8-week duration) showed a \> or = 1 g/dL increase in hemoglobin over baseline. These subjects received 100mcg of weekly Erythropoietin and up to three 500mg doses of Venofer at intervals of 2 to 3 weeks with last dose no later than Week 9 of Stage 2. | 59 |
| Group B: Erythropoietin Only (Responders) Subjects who at any time during Stage 1 (8-week duration) showed a \> or = 1 g/dL increase in hemoglobin over baseline. These subjects received 100mcg of weekly Erythropoietin only. | 77 |
| Group C: Erythropoietin + Venofer (Non-responders) Subjects whose maximum hemoglobin increase was \< 1 g/dL over baseline were designated as Stage 1 (8-week duration) non-responders. These subjects received 100mcg of weekly Erythropoietin and up to three 500mg doses of Venofer at intervals of 2 to 3 weeks with last dose no later than Week 9 of Stage 2. | 40 |
| Group D: Erythropoietin Only (Non-responders) Subjects whose maximum hemoglobin increase was \< 1 g/dL over baseline were designated as Stage 1 (8-week duration) non-responders. These subjects received 100mcg of weekly Erythropoietin only. | 48 |
| Total | 224 |

Outcome results
Change From Baseline to the Maximum Hemoglobin Level During Stage 2 (Week 9 Through Week 21).
The hemoglobin baseline was defined as the average of the last 2 hemoglobin values during stage 1 (through week 8).
Time frame: During Stage 2 (week 9 through week 21)
Population: intention to treat (ITT)
| Arm | Measure | Value (MEAN) | Dispersion |
|---|---|---|---|
| Group A: Erythropoietin + Venofer (Responders) | Change From Baseline to the Maximum Hemoglobin Level During Stage 2 (Week 9 Through Week 21). | 2.6 g/dL | Standard Deviation 1.59 |
| Group B: Erythropoietin Only (Responders) | Change From Baseline to the Maximum Hemoglobin Level During Stage 2 (Week 9 Through Week 21). | 1.8 g/dL | Standard Deviation 1.39 |
| Group C: Erythropoietin + Venofer (Non-responders) | Change From Baseline to the Maximum Hemoglobin Level During Stage 2 (Week 9 Through Week 21). | 2.5 g/dL | Standard Deviation 1.88 |
| Group D: Erythropoietin Only (Non-responders) | Change From Baseline to the Maximum Hemoglobin Level During Stage 2 (Week 9 Through Week 21). | 1.3 g/dL | Standard Deviation 1.73 |
